Desert Preschool Academy is Hiring a Teacher Assistant Near Coachella, CA

We are looking for an experienced and enthusiastic Teacher Assistant to join our team and help us ensure the happiness and well-being of our youngest students. The ideal candidate will have additional experience with children, possess a Child Development degree, 12 units in Early childhood Education. The ideal candidate will have experience and enjoy working in a fun, fast-paced environment that is focused on education. We offer many benefits including comprehensive health, dental plans, and vision plan to ensure you have balance in your life.

Minimum Qualifications Requirement

Education: Must be enrolled in college and must have completed 6 college units in early childhood core classes.

Experience: Previous teaching assistant experience or experience working with children.

Personal Qualities: Need to be friendly and inviting. Need to adapt easily and enjoy learning.

Other Employment Requirements

TB Clearance/Physical

Fingerprinting Clearance

CPR/ First Aid Certification

Vaccines/ Flu Shot – Pertussis and measles

Responsibilities:

  • Make learning fun for our youngest students.
  • Help prepare young children for kindergarten.
  • Give kids a fun and safe learning environment.
  • Guide children with daily activities, from arts and crafts to promote a healthy and learning environment.
  • Be patient and understanding with children of all ages and backgrounds.

Quotes from people on Teacher Assistant job description and responsibilities

Teacher assistants typically work closely with students to help them understand and apply principles taught by the classroom teacher.

12/17/2021: Orange, CA

Many teacher assistants work closely with special education teachers to assist students with physical, emotional, mental, and learning disabilities.

02/02/2022: Richmond, VA

Teacher assistants work under the guidance of a licensed teacher to help perform many classroom tasks, ranging from organizing classroom materials to setting up equipment that teachers will use to carry out lessons.

02/22/2022: Brownsville, TX

Teaching assistants may also help students with research skills, or help teachers by grading tests, checking homework, and taking attendance.

01/09/2022: New London, CT

Teacher assistants reinforce lessons given by the teachers by reviewing materials with their students or assist those that may need extra help.
